Transaction 2104487b7fe29487ad723e6dcf9a47e7ceeecbdab8670a8d7ec46620496201c0

1 Input
2 Outputs
  • 2104487b7fe29487ad723e6dcf9a47e7ceeecbdab8670a8d7ec46620496201c0:0
  • value  658333
    address  1569ZE7RqmsaPpGDgaTrBNmz5xjAHf8yzw
  • 2104487b7fe29487ad723e6dcf9a47e7ceeecbdab8670a8d7ec46620496201c0:1
  • value  1783030219
    address  39sfuA8pY4UfybgEZi7uvA13jkGzZpsg5K